Though there will obviously be improvements, the jump from DX10 to DX11 isn't anywhere near the scale of the DX9 - 10 jump. It's very similar to DX10.1, which is a a derivative of DX10 anyway. #2.2

You don't need to spend 2 grand on a PC to play those games. The difference between the i7 920 and 965 is negligible when playing games, though there's a huge difference in price. You can get 6GB of DDR3 RAM for around 80 quid now, and a single Geforce GTX275 is more than enough to play any of the games at any resolution, bar perhaps 2560 - But then who really plays at that res anyway. #1.3
